Understanding Microphone Boom Basics

A microphone boom, also known as a boom arm or mic stand, is a versatile piece of equipment used to securely position microphones for optimal recording or broadcasting. It typically consists of a flexible metal arm that can be adjusted to different angles and lengths, allowing users to easily position the microphone in various directions and distances.

One of the primary benefits of using a microphone boom is its ability to free up desk space and reduce clutter. By mounting the microphone on a boom arm, users can position the mic closer to their mouth for clearer audio capture without the need for a bulky microphone stand taking up valuable desk real estate.

Microphone booms are commonly used in recording studios, radio stations, podcasting setups, and video production environments. They offer greater flexibility and control over microphone positioning, making them essential tools for professionals and enthusiasts looking to achieve high-quality sound recordings.

In addition to positioning advantages, microphone booms also help reduce handling noise and vibrations that can distort audio quality. By suspending the microphone in the air using a boom arm, users can minimize unwanted noises caused by desk vibrations or accidental bumps, resulting in cleaner and more professional-sounding recordings.

Boom Arm Types And Features

Boom arms come in various types and feature sets to cater to different needs and preferences. When considering boom arm types, one key distinction is between desk-mounted and floor-standing options. Desk-mounted boom arms typically offer flexibility and convenience for close-range recordings, while floor-standing models provide more stability and mobility for larger setups or dynamic recording situations.

Another crucial aspect to consider is the boom arm’s range of motion and adjustability. Some boom arms offer 360-degree rotation, horizontal extension, and vertical tilt, providing users with versatile positioning options to optimize their recording setup. Additionally, features like internal springs for counterbalancing weight can help maintain microphone placement and reduce unwanted noise during recordings.

Boom arms may also vary in their construction materials, such as steel or aluminum, affecting durability and weight capacity. Certain models come with integrated cable management systems to keep cords organized and prevent tangling, contributing to a clean and professional workspace. Furthermore, compatibility with various microphone types and shock mounts should be assessed to ensure seamless integration with existing equipment.

How To Set Up Your Microphone Boom

Setting up your microphone boom correctly is crucial to achieving optimal audio quality for your recordings or live sessions. To start, position your microphone at the appropriate height and angle to ensure it captures your voice clearly. Adjust the boom arm extension and rotation to achieve the desired placement.

Next, secure the microphone in place using the boom arm’s tightening mechanisms. Ensure that the microphone is stable and does not wobble during use. Additionally, check the cable connections to ensure a secure and stable audio signal flow.

Consider using a shock mount or pop filter to further enhance audio quality by minimizing vibrations and reducing plosive sounds. These accessories can greatly improve the overall sound clarity of your recordings.

Lastly, test your microphone setup by recording a sample audio clip and adjusting as needed. Pay attention to any unwanted background noise, distortions, or imbalances in sound. Fine-tune your setup until you are satisfied with the audio quality, taking into account the acoustics of your recording environment.

How Do You Properly Set Up And Adjust A Microphone Boom For Optimal Performance?

To set up a microphone boom for optimal performance, start by securing the boom arm to a stable stand or mount. Position the microphone at a 45-degree angle pointing towards the sound source, ideally 6-12 inches away. Adjust the height to align with the speaker’s mouth level for clear audio pickup. Use a pop filter to minimize plosive sounds and a shock mount to reduce vibrations and handling noise for a clean recording.

For further fine-tuning, adjust the angle and distance based on the sound source, environment, and desired audio quality. Test the microphone placement by recording and monitoring sound levels to ensure optimal performance.
